Market Context

UPS operates in the global package delivery and logistics sector, which has posted mixed performance across the broader market in recent weeks. Based on public market data, the transportation sector as a whole has faced offsetting headwinds and tailwinds: fluctuating global fuel costs, shifting consumer spending preferences for services over physical goods, and mild uncertainty around cross-border trade volumes have weighed on some segments, while growing demand for specialized logistics solutions for healthcare supplies, high-value consumer goods, and sustainable delivery options have supported upside for larger players with diversified service lines. In terms of trading activity, UPS has seen normal volume in recent sessions, with trading levels roughly in line with its trailing average. Market expectations for the sector remain split, with some analysts pointing to potential upside from stabilizing e-commerce shipping volumes as peak summer delivery season approaches, while others note risks from a potential slowdown in corporate shipping demand if broad economic growth cools in upcoming months. Technical Analysis

From a technical trading perspective, market participants are tracking two clear key levels for UPS in the near term. The first is a support level at $93.17, which has acted as a reliable floor for price action in recent weeks, with buyers consistently stepping in to absorb selling pressure whenever the stock approaches this threshold. On the upside, a key resistance level sits at $102.97, a price point that has capped multiple recent upward attempts, as sellers enter the market to lock in profits near that threshold.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the neutral mid-40s range, signaling that it is neither overbought nor oversold at current levels, leaving room for potential movement in either direction depending on shifts in broader market sentiment. UPS is also trading near its short-term moving average, with longer-term moving averages sitting slightly above current price levels, indicating that the stock is in a tentative near-term trend as traders wait for a clearer catalyst to drive sustained directional movement. Outlook

Looking ahead, technical analysts are tracking two plausible near-term scenarios for UPS. In a more positive scenario, if the stock can hold above current price levels and build on its recent gains, it could possibly test the $102.97 resistance level in upcoming sessions. A sustained break above this resistance level on higher-than-average volume would likely signal increased buying interest and may open the door to further near-term upside, though broader sector trends and macroeconomic data releases would remain key factors influencing how far any upward move could extend. In a more cautious scenario, if broader market sentiment turns negative or selling pressure picks up across the transportation sector, UPS might test the $93.17 support level. A break below this support level could trigger further near-term selling, as stop-loss orders placed near that level may be activated, leading to increased volume on downward moves. Without scheduled earnings releases in the immediate term, technical levels and broader macroeconomic updates, including consumer spending reports and fuel price movements, will likely be the primary drivers of UPS’s price action in the coming weeks.
